Contents
プログラミングソフトを無料で使いたい小学生のあなたへ
プログラミングを学ぶことは、今の時代において非常に重要です。特に小学生のうちからプログラミングを学ぶことで、論理的思考力や問題解決能力を養うことができます。しかし、親としては「どのプログラミングソフトを使えばよいのか?」や「無料で使えるソフトはないのか?」と悩むことも多いでしょう。そこで、今回は小学生向けの無料プログラミングソフトについて詳しくお話しします。あなたが求める情報をしっかりお届けしますので、ぜひ最後までお読みください。
なぜプログラミングを学ぶべきなのか?
まずは、プログラミングを学ぶ重要性についてお話しします。プログラミングは単にコンピュータを操作するだけでなく、思考の幅を広げる手段でもあります。特に小学生のあなたがプログラミングを学ぶことで得られるメリットは以下の通りです。
- 論理的思考力が身につく
- 創造力を引き出すことができる
- 問題解決能力が向上する
- 未来の仕事に役立つスキルを身につけられる
これらのスキルは、将来どのような職業に就くにしても役立ちます。また、プログラミングを通じて自分のアイデアを形にする楽しさを知ることができるのも大きな魅力です。
無料で使えるプログラミングソフトの選び方
次に、無料のプログラミングソフトを選ぶ際のポイントをお伝えします。以下の基準を参考にすることで、あなたに合ったソフトを見つけやすくなります。
1. 使いやすさ
まずは、インターフェースが直感的で使いやすいソフトを選びましょう。特に小学生の場合、複雑な操作が必要なソフトは挫折の原因になることがあります。
2. 学習リソースの充実
次に、学習リソースが充実しているかどうかも重要です。チュートリアルやサンプルプロジェクトが豊富に用意されているソフトは、よりスムーズに学ぶことができます。
3. コミュニティの存在
最後に、ユーザー同士のコミュニティが活発なソフトを選ぶと良いでしょう。質問や相談ができる場所があると、学習が進みやすくなります。
おすすめの無料プログラミングソフト
それでは、具体的にどのプログラミングソフトが無料で使えるのか、いくつかご紹介します。これらのソフトは、特に小学生に人気があります。
1. Scratch
Scratchは、子ども向けに開発されたビジュアルプログラミング言語です。ブロックを組み合わせることで簡単にプログラムを作成できます。多くのチュートリアルが用意されており、世界中のユーザーと作品を共有することもできます。
2. Code.org
Code.orgは、オンラインでプログラミングを学べるプラットフォームです。多様なゲームやアニメーションを通じて、楽しくプログラミングの基礎を学べます。特に「Hour of Code」というイベントが有名で、子どもたちが一斉にプログラミングを体験する機会が提供されています。
3. Tynker
Tynkerは、ゲームを作成しながらプログラミングを学べるオンラインプラットフォームです。基本的なプログラミングの概念を学びつつ、自分だけのゲームを作成する楽しさを体験できます。基本的な機能は無料で使用可能です。
4. Python
Pythonは、簡単に始められるプログラミング言語で、無料で利用できるIDE(統合開発環境)も豊富にあります。Pythonを学ぶことで、基本的なプログラミングの概念をしっかり理解できるでしょう。特に「CodeCombat」や「Codecademy」などの学習サイトが役立ちます。
プログラミングを楽しむためのポイント
プログラミングは、ただ学ぶだけではなく楽しむことが重要です。以下のポイントを意識することで、より楽しい学びの時間を過ごせます。
- 自分の興味のあるテーマでプロジェクトを作成する
- 友達と一緒に学んで競い合う
- オンラインコミュニティで他の作品を見て刺激を受ける
- 失敗を恐れず、試行錯誤を楽しむ
プログラミングは、試行錯誤の連続です。失敗から学ぶことが多いので、楽しみながら取り組む姿勢が大切です。
まとめ
プログラミングソフトを無料で使いたい小学生のあなたに向けて、プログラミングの重要性や無料で使えるソフトの選び方、おすすめのソフトについてお伝えしました。ScratchやCode.orgなどのプログラミングソフトは、あなたの学びをサポートしてくれる存在です。楽しみながらプログラミングを学び、未来の可能性を広げていきましょう。あなたがどのソフトを選ぶにしても、興味を持って取り組むことが何よりも大切です。